軟件構造

6.1 Robustness and Correctness     健壯性與正確性 健壯性:系統在不正常輸入或不正常外部環境下仍能夠表現正常。 而且即使因爲意外終止執行了,也要向用戶展示準確的錯誤信息。 面向健壯性的編程要求封閉實現細節,以達到限定用戶的惡意行爲的目的,並且要考慮到各種各樣大的極端情況,假設用戶可以做任何事情。 目的是讓用戶變得更容易:出錯也可以容忍,因爲程序內部已有容錯機制。
相關文章
相關標籤/搜索